Transaction 706fcdd302d77cb1c9ac8a5ba2be30f75b43bff02db055c3c11f42c20d26b53b

block
3ec8145ce3a3a6afe5b608100207e5452278a9d9f4c0ac38cf0933666f9cbcce

1 Input

25 Outputs